Job Overview

A well-established law firm is seeking a Workers' Compensation Defense Attorney to join its team, focusing on appearances and case management throughout Southern California. The role is ideal for an attorney with at least two years of experience in workers' compensation defense who is looking for a balanced caseload, strong administrative support, and a paperless work environment. This is a full-time position based in or near Orange County, offering competitive compensation and comprehensive benefits.
